Визуализация работы поисковой системы: индексация, ранжирование и выдача результатов поиска Визуализация работы поисковой системы: индексация, ранжирование и выдача результатов поиска

Как работают поисковые системы: взгляд изнутри

Узнайте, как работают поисковые системы изнутри! Как они находят и ранжируют информацию? Загляните за кулисы интернет-поиска.

Поисковые системы стали неотъемлемой частью нашей повседневной жизни. Мы используем их для поиска информации, товаров, услуг, новостей и многого другого. Но задумывались ли вы когда-нибудь о том, как именно работают поисковые системы? Этот вопрос требует подробного рассмотрения, ведь за простым интерфейсом скрывается сложный механизм, включающий в себя сканирование, индексацию и ранжирование веб-страниц.

В этой статье мы подробно рассмотрим, как работают поисковые системы, от первых шагов сканирования интернета до момента, когда вы видите результаты поиска. Мы также обсудим, как улучшить позиции вашего сайта в выдаче поисковиков, используя знания о факторах ранжирования поисковых систем.

Погружение в мир поисковых систем: от запроса до результата

Поисковая система – это, по сути, огромная база данных, организованная таким образом, чтобы пользователи могли быстро и эффективно находить нужную им информацию в интернете. Ее роль сложно переоценить, ведь она является главным инструментом навигации во всемирной сети, позволяя ориентироваться в бесчисленном количестве веб-страниц. Поисковые машины, такие как Google, Яндекс и Bing, постоянно сканируют и индексируют сайты, чтобы предоставить пользователям актуальную и релевантную информацию.

История развития поисковых систем началась с простых каталогов, которые вручную составлялись и обновлялись людьми. Однако с ростом интернета стало очевидно, что такой подход не масштабируем. Появились первые алгоритмические системы поиска информации, которые автоматически индексировали веб-страницы. Сегодняшние алгоритмы поиска – это сложные комплексы, использующие машинное обучение и искусственный интеллект для предоставления наиболее релевантных результатов поиска.

Основные компоненты поисковой системы:

  • Поисковый робот (паук, краулер): Программа, которая сканирует интернет, переходя по ссылкам и собирая информацию с веб-страниц.
  • Индекс: Огромная база данных, содержащая информацию о всех проиндексированных веб-страницах.
  • Алгоритм ранжирования: Комплекс правил и алгоритмов, определяющий порядок, в котором результаты поиска отображаются пользователю. Один из известных ранних алгоритмов — алгоритм PageRank, используемый Google.

Принцип работы поисковых систем: пошаговый разбор

Принцип работы поисковых систем основан на трех основных этапах: сканировании и индексации сайтов, формировании индекса и обработке поискового запроса.

Сканирование и индексация сайтов: Как поисковый робот находит информацию? Поисковый робот, или краулер, начинает свою работу с небольшого списка известных веб-страниц. Затем он переходит по ссылкам, найденным на этих страницах, и сканирует новые страницы, добавляя их в свой список. Этот процесс продолжается до тех пор, пока не будет просканировано огромное количество страниц. Важно отметить, что процесс сканирования управляется множеством факторов, таких как частота обновления сайта, его авторитетность и правила, указанные в файле robots.txt.

Схема работы поисковой системы, показывающая этапы сканирования, индексации и ранжирования веб-страниц.
Основные этапы работы поисковой системы.

Важно: Правильная настройка robots.txt позволяет управлять тем, какие страницы вашего сайта будут сканироваться и индексироваться поисковыми системами.

Формирование индекса: После сканирования страницы информация, полученная с нее, анализируется и добавляется в индекс. Индекс – это огромная база данных, содержащая информацию о каждом слове и фразе, найденных на проиндексированных веб-страницах. Организация данных для быстрого поиска в индексе имеет решающее значение для скорости и эффективности поисковой системы.

Обработка поискового запроса: Когда пользователь вводит запрос в поисковую систему, она анализирует запрос и пытается понять, что именно ищет пользователь. Затем поисковик просматривает индекс и находит страницы, которые соответствуют запросу. После этого страницы ранжируются в соответствии с алгоритмом ранжирования поисковой системы, и результаты отображаются пользователю. Как поисковые системы определяют релевантность? Релевантность определяется множеством факторов, включая соответствие ключевых слов, авторитетность страницы и удобство использования для пользователя.

Индексация сайтов: как добавить свой сайт в поисковую систему

Как поисковик индексирует сайты? Процесс индексации включает в себя сканирование веб-страниц поисковым роботом, анализ содержимого страницы и добавление информации о странице в индекс поисковой системы. Этот процесс является ключевым для того, чтобы ваш сайт был виден в результатах поиска.

Для управления процессом индексации используются несколько инструментов:

  • Файл robots.txt: Этот файл позволяет управлять доступом поисковых роботов к вашему сайту. Вы можете указать, какие страницы или разделы сайта не следует сканировать и индексировать. Подробнее о robots.txt можно узнать в официальной Google документации.
  • Sitemap.xml: Карта сайта – это файл, содержащий список всех страниц вашего сайта. Предоставление карты сайта поисковой системе облегчает ей сканирование и индексацию вашего сайта.
  • Инструменты для веб-мастеров: Как добавить сайт в поисковую систему? Google Search Console и Яндекс.Вебмастер предоставляют инструменты для управления индексацией вашего сайта. Вы можете отправить карту сайта, проверить статус индексации и узнать о проблемах, препятствующих индексации. Чтобы добавить сайт в Google, используйте Google Search Console.

Вот пример таблицы с основными инструментами для управления индексацией:

ИнструментОписаниеСсылка
robots.txtУправление доступом поисковых роботов к сайту.Google Search Central
Sitemap.xmlКарта сайта для облегчения индексации.Google Search Central
Google Search ConsoleИнструменты для управления индексацией, отправки карты сайта и проверки статуса.Google Search Console
Яндекс.ВебмастерАналогичные инструменты для поисковой системы Яндекс.Яндекс.Вебмастер

Совет профи: Регулярно проверяйте состояние индексации вашего сайта в Google Search Console и Яндекс.Вебмастере, чтобы выявлять и устранять проблемы, препятствующие индексации. Это поможет убедиться, что ваш контент виден поисковым системам.

Важно: Если ваш сайт не отображается в поиске, убедитесь, что он проиндексирован поисковой системой и что нет ошибок, препятствующих индексации. Проверьте файл robots.txt и карту сайта, а также используйте инструменты для веб-мастеров, чтобы получить более подробную информацию.

Что делать дальше?

Теперь, когда вы знаете, как работают алгоритмы поисковых систем Google и других поисковиков, пришло время применить эти знания на практике. Начните с анализа вашего сайта и оптимизации его для поисковых систем. Убедитесь, что ваш сайт легко сканируется и индексируется, что контент релевантен и полезен для пользователей, и что сайт имеет хорошую репутацию в интернете. Улучшение позиций сайта в поисковых системах – это непрерывный процесс, требующий постоянного мониторинга и анализа.

Как работают поисковые системы: взгляд изнутри